We run hospitals on Elixir. We’ve embraced Elixir for its fault tolerance, concurrency, and scalability - essential for handling
real-time patient data in mission-critical settings like Emergency Departments, ICUs, and Operating Rooms.

Senior Software Engineer (Java), Financial Products The Financial Products team at Adyen is at the forefront of our evolution, building the foundational infrastructure that enables our customers to manage their finances, issue cards, and access capital globally. As a Senior Software Engineer, you will play a critical role in developing a high-integrity financial ecosystem that goes far beyond traditional payments. This suite of recently launched products offers a rare opportunity to solve deep architectural challenges from engineering immutable ledgers and real-time decisioning engines to scaling a unified platform that operates across multiple regulatory jurisdictions.
